evento
event
noun eh-BEHN-toh Less Common
Origin: From Latin eventus (outcome, occurrence).
Usage Note
Evento is a direct borrowing that has displaced the older acontecimiento in modern media and marketing Spanish. Purists and some style guides prefer acto, celebración, or suceso for formal writing, but evento is fully standard in journalism and everyday speech across all Spanish-speaking countries. It almost always refers to a planned, organised occasion rather than a chance happening.
Examples
"El evento deportivo empieza a las ocho."
Natural Translation
The sports event starts at eight.
Literal Translation
The event sports begins at the eight
